LOS ANGELES (thefutoncritic.com) -- The latest development news, culled from recent wire reports:

AMERICAN DAD/COSMOS/FAMILY GUY/THE ORVILLE (Various) - Executive producer Seth MacFarlane has reportedly signed a giant five-year, nine-figure overall deal with NBCUniversal Content Studios, ending his two decade run at 20th Century Fox Television. There he'll develop new series projects via his Fuzzy Door Productions banner. (Deadline.com)
ARRANGED (CBS, New!) - Farhan Arshad has sold a new comedy to the Eye about "the messy but ultimately hopeful relationship between Sabrina and Samir, two polar opposites, who get set up by their families after they have trouble finding true love on their own." Sutton Street Productions' Jennie Snyder Urman and Joanna Klein and The Nacelle Company's Michael Pelmont will also executive produce for CBS Television Studios. (Deadline.com)
GREY'S ANATOMY (ABC) - Original cast member Justin Chambers is exiting the series after 16 seasons. His character, Alex Karev, was last seen on the show's November 14 episode, one that "was likely his last episode on the show for the foreseeable future." (Deadline.com)
NIGHT SCHOOL (NBC, New!) - The Peacock has ordered a pilot for a multi-camera comedy based on the Kevin Hart-led feature of the same name, about "a unique mix of adults at a night school GED prep class who unexpectedly bond over their shared experience and find themselves helping each other both inside and outside of the classroom." Bicycle Path Productions' Christopher Moynihan penned the pilot for Universal Television with Hartbeat Productions' Kevin Hart; Will Packer Media's Will Packer and Sheila Duckworth; and Malcolm D. Lee, the feature's director, also executive producing. (Deadline.com)
NOBODY'S PRINCESS (Amazon) - The proposed musical series, which reimagines the stories of four classic fairy tale princesses for today's generation, has found a new home at the streaming service. Originally set up at The CW in November 2018, Nicole Delaney has since come aboard to pen the script alongside Alan Zachary and Michael Weiner. Erin Cardillo and Richard Keith are no longer actively attached due to their overall deal with Warner Bros. Television. They will remain as executive producers, as will Fulwell 73's James Corden, Ben Winston, Leo Pearlman and Jeff Grosvenor for CBS Television Studios. (Deadline.com)
OUTMATCHED (FOX) - Tony Danza will guest on the newcomer as Jason Biggs's "retired bulldozer of a father, up from Florida for a visit." (Deadline.com)
